About Access Folk - University of Sheffield

WebAccess Folk supports and explores ways to increase and diversify participation in English folk singing. Access Folk is built on co-production principles where the people affected have real power to direct the research. Access Folk will trial and evaluate new approaches in collaboration with the wider folk singing scene.

Origins In the strictest sense, English folk music has existed since the arrival of the Anglo-Saxon people in Britain after 400 CE. The Venerable Bede's story of the cattleman and later ecclesiastical musician Cædmon indicates that in the early medieval period it was normal at feasts to pass around the harp … See more The folk music of England is a tradition-based music which has existed since the later medieval period. It is often contrasted with courtly, classical and later commercial music.
